The below graph shows the average detached house price in the Staffordshire Moorlands local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The two 93 CAVERSWALL ROAD sales from November 1999 and September 2005 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the November 1999 sale was for 79% above the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 79% above the HPI over time, until the September 2005 sale, where it falls to 44% above the HPI. The line then continues to track at 44% above the HPI.

What might 93 CAVERSWALL ROAD be worth now?

93 CAVERSWALL ROAD might now be worth an estimated £447,650.

This is based on house price inflation of 64%, between September 2005 and December 2024, for detached houses, in the Staffordshire Moorlands local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 64%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 93 CAVERSWALL ROAD of £273,000 on 13th September 2005. For the value to have increased from £273,000 to £447,650 over the eighteen years and nine months to December 2024,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 93 CAVERSWALL ROAD has moved in line with the HPI for detached houses in the Staffordshire Moorlands local authority area.
  • The September 2005 sale price of £273,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 93 CAVERSWALL ROAD has not materially changed since September 2005.

93 CAVERSWALL ROAD: Plot and Title Map

93 CAVERSWALL ROAD sits on a plot of roughly 0.144 of an acre, or 583m². The below map shows the location of 93 CAVERSWALL ROAD, an approximate outline of the building(s), and the indicative extent of the property. The plot extent is a Land Registry INSPIRE Index Polygon, and it is important to note that a title may include more than one polygon, whereas only one polygon is shown on the map (the polygon which intersects with the position of 93 CAVERSWALL ROAD). The full extent of the land contained in any registered title can only be identified from the individual title plan. The maps on this page should not be relied upon to establish the extent of a title.
